Hi all experts,
I am looking for a remote(Slingbox 500) to control my Mut@nt HD500C.
Any suggestions? Thanks
Under "Remote control type setup" in settings for Mutant the remote seems to be compatible with:
HD1100, HD1200, HD1265, HD1500, HD500C, HD530C, VS1000, VS1500, et7x00, et8500, et7000mini
The remote looks like this:
https://www.asat.nl/Webwinkel-Product-157720715/Mutant-HD-500c-1100-1200-1265-1500-afstandsbediening.html
Mut@nt
HD1100, HD1200, HD1265, HD1500, HD500C, HD530C
http://mutant-digital.net/
Vimastec
VS1000, VS1500
http://vimastec.com/
Xtrend
et7x00, et8500, et7000mini

Hi again,
One thing I noticed now when I stream through my android mobile Slingbox app. When I press MISC and then Volume Up / Down buttons I adjust only the volume of the phone and can not increase the volume of Mut@nt box. So if I forget the volume on low and leave home I can't increase the volume of Mut@nt.
Is it possible to connect the volume to two custom buttons, up / down?
With the computer I can control the volume when I right click on control and go to General->Volume Up/Down , but not with phone app.
Thanks |

That is standard procedure. Sling have always hijacked the volume controls for use by the player. I've revised the BIN files so the volume codes are now generated by the Page+/- buttons. |
